Elinchrom's EL-Skyport RX Trigger Set includes a Skyport SPEED Transmitter, 2 ELS RX Transceivers, and a 7.8" (19 cm) sync cord, with which you can change the flash output, and control the modeling light, and flash synchronization on the Style RX 300/600/1200, Digital RX 1200/2400, Ranger RX/Ranger RX Speed/Ranger RX Speed AS (the Ranger battery power pack requires the EL-Skyport Transceiver RX Adapter, 19374).
The RX Trigger Set works at distances up to 196' (60 m) indoors; up to 393' (120 m) outdoors, and up to 1/250s shutter speed. It can control flashes in 4 selectable workgroups, and there are 8 frequency channels. To control all RX functions (such as as Strobing, Counter and more) of Style RX, Ranger RX, Ranger Quadra RX (only Ranger Quadra RX with serial numbers from 4001 onwards) and Digital RX from a computer, the USB Transceiver RX 19354/19348 (not included) and the latest EL Skyport software (not included) are required. With 40-bit security, you get interference-free operation.
The transmitter can synchronize remote flash units when each is fitted with either a "Universal" receiver fitting all flash brands (not included) or the included Transceiver RX (fitting Style RX, Digital RX and Ranger RX units) or units with EL-Skyport Transceiver built-in (BXRi 250/500 & Ranger Quadra AS). The transmitter operates using an internal rechargeable battery that's good for up to 30,000 flashes. The transceiver operates without a battery, drawing power from the strobe it's attached to,

Got these for an outdoor shoot. I did not want to run around to set power levels in front of my client for the numerous shots planned. The transmitter gave me one tenth of a stop per button press. Worked perfectly.
I did notice the on/off switch on the transmitter can easily and accidentally be switched off. So keep an eye on the switches while you work. Other than that - excellent addition to my kit.

I have an older Elinchrome AS3000 powerpack with three heads and a new Elinchrom 1200RX strobe. This set works with the 1200RX and easily increases or decreases the flash intensity. The receivers take their power from the RX heads so no batteries needed there and the transmitter uses a flat lithium battery so there's no need to charge and easy to carry a spare. The transmitter and receivers are as small and light as I can imagine and you wouldn't think there was room in the camera unit for the flat battery. It's that small.
The unit lets you fire specific strobes or all strobes as a group. I find this useful when setting-up the lighting.
The transmitter attaches to the camera hot shoe but can also works off-shoe with a PC cord connector (included), which is handy for attaching to your meter or a non-SLR camera (I use 4x5 view cameras as well as SLRs).
The transmitter works well with the Skyport Universal Receiver that I added to handle the older strobe. No controls there... just a wireless trigger. [Note: The Universal Receiver has to be charged. It's not a big deal but one more thing to do. I'd rather that used the same battery as the transmitter.]
I don't happen to use the unit with computer controls for strobing, etc. Not my thing. But, everything works extremely well. Good for anyone. If you have an Elinchrom RX unit I cannot imagine any other choice.
